NBA: Heat Ignite, Pistons Roar

The Miami Heat turned the dial to eleven, scorching the Washington Wizards with a staggering 150-129 victory. Their offense was simply unstoppable, shooting a blistering 57% from the field. It was an offensive clinic that left the Wizards searching for answers.

Meanwhile, the Detroit Pistons made a thunderous statement, absolutely decimating the Brooklyn Nets in a 138-100 blowout. Detroit shot an impressive 55% while stifling Brooklyn to just 38% from the field. This wasn't just a win; it was an emphatic declaration from a team proving it can truly hoop.

  • Miami Heat: 150 points vs. Wizards (W 150-129), 57% field goal percentage.
  • Detroit Pistons: Dominate Nets (W 138-100) with a 38-point margin, shooting 55% vs. Nets' 38%.

NHL: Wild Shutout, Canadiens Upset

On the ice, the Minnesota Wild put on a defensive masterclass, completely shutting down the Utah Mammoth in a dominant 5-0 rout. Their impenetrable defense combined with a relentless offense left Utah scoreless and frustrated. This was a statement win built on defensive strength.

In a surprising turn, the Montreal Canadiens stunned the Toronto Maple Leafs with a solid 3-1 home victory. Montreal's power play was particularly effective, converting 50% of their chances with two man-advantage goals, much to the delight of the roaring home crowd.

  • Minnesota Wild: Blanks Utah Mammoth (W 5-0), proving defensive might.
  • Montreal Canadiens: Upsets Maple Leafs (W 3-1), fueled by strong power play.

MLB: Athletics Slugfest, Padres Crush

Baseball got off to an explosive start as the Oakland Athletics outslugged the Chicago White Sox in a wild 11-7 affair. Brent Rooker led the charge, posting a stellar 71.5 MLBRating in a game filled with offensive fireworks. The A's offense looks primed for a big season.

The San Diego Padres also brought their bats, crushing the Los Angeles Angels 10-2 in a dominant road performance. Their offensive onslaught left no doubt, showcasing San Diego's firepower early in the season.

  • Oakland Athletics: Outslug White Sox (W 11-7), Brent Rooker (71.5 MLBRating) shines.
  • San Diego Padres: Decimate Angels (W 10-2) in a powerful offensive display.
